§ 16-42-20-11 — Anonymity of research subjects

The Indiana board of pharmacy may authorize persons engaged in research on the use and effects of controlled substances to withhold the names and other identifying characteristics of individuals who are the subjects of the research. Persons who obtain this authorization may not be compelled in any civil, criminal, administrative, legislative, or other proceeding to identify the individuals who are the subjects of research for which the authorization was obtained. [Pre-1993 Recodification Citation: 16-6-8.5-8(d).]
